Bar & Bar Mitzvah Plates

Our Bat & Bar Mitzvah Plates are Bar/Bat Mitzva certificates bringing the details of the Bat or Bar Mizvah celebration on a hand made ceramic tile.
Each Bar & Bat Mitzvah Plate carries the common and Hebrew date of the Bat/Bar Mizva celebration; the name of the Parashah (Torah portion) of the celebration's day; the Boy's or Girl's English and Hebrew names, and extra custom details as the name of the congregation, the name of the Rabbi or Cantor who taught the boy, or few greeting words.

The design of the Ceramic Bat & Bar Mitzvah Plate divides it into two parts, the decoration area and the personal inscription area.
The plates are decorated using a mixed technique combining hand painting (8 colors) and silkscreening of black outlines.
All inscriptions are hand written by me.
Every tile is washable in case of need.

Follows some information about the Decoration and Custom Inscription areas:

The Decoration Area

The surrounding decoration of the Bar & Bat Mitzvah Plate is a composition of few main landmarks of the Jerusalem skyline and different Bar and Bat Mitzvah symbols.

On the left decoration panel:

- The Tower of David and the Dome of the Rock
- The old city walls with the Hebrew text from Mishlei, Book of Proverbs (4,2) reading Ki lekach tov natati lachem, torati al ta'azovu (For I give you good doctrine; forsake ye not my teaching)
- Mount Zion
- Montefiore Windmill
- YMCA building
- Shrine of the Book at Israel Museum
- Western Wall (Kotel Hama'aravi)
- Rampant lion, symbol of the tribe of Judah and Jerusalem.

On the right decoration panel:

- Tablets of the covenant with a crown and the Hebrew words Keter Torah (Torah Crown)
- For boys: a pair of Tefillin (phylacteries) along with the Hebrew letters Bet-Samech-Daled, the acronim of Besyatah Deshmayah (Aramaic: "With God's Help")
- For girls: a pair of Shabbat Candles
- A partly unrolled Torah Scroll
- Two illustrations of Torah reading.

The Custom Inscription Area

This part of the Bar Mitzvah Plate carries the personal details of the Bar/Bat Mizvah, in Hebrew and English. It is written according to the information you supply during the order process.
Please note that the entire inscription is written with a free hand, and therefore the lettering differs slightly with each name or letter combination.

The central area of the Bar and Bat Mitzva plate carries two sets of details, a standard inscription of the Bar-Bat Mitzvah's name and ceremony, and optional additional details.

The inscription elements:

- Date of event according to Regular and Jewish calendars
- Hebrew name of the Parasha (portion of the Torah) read by the Boy
- Boy's or Girl Jewish name, in Hebrew letters
- Boy's or girl's English name, in Latin letters
OF COURSE, if you ask to add the family name as well, the font size will be smaller

- The sentence: "Was called up to the Torah as a Bar Mitzvah" (or "Bat Mitzvah" for a girl)

Additional details:

In the lower part of the inscription area of the plate, there is place for two additional details: at left you may ask for congregation's name and location, while at right you can have added the name of the Cantor or of the Rabbi who taught the boy, or a very short greeting like "Mazel Tov from Aba & Ima".
